Settlement that proves itself

Four things the chain does that a payment rail cannot.

The primitive: settlement that proves itself

  • Payment and invoice bound cryptographically at birth. Nothing to match, ever.
  • Settled only when paid equals due. Duplicates and overpayments rejected atomically.
  • Append-only: bounces, refunds, and disputes land as typed, provable events.

The asset: receivables as native RWA

  • Every unpaid invoice is timestamped, unalterable, not double-sellable, with live paid/unpaid state.
  • An ERC-1155 receivables marketplace to trade and finance real cash flows, not synthetic yield.
  • The RWA thesis with actual volume behind it. Invoices are how real money already moves.

The architecture: dual-ledger

  • TigerBeetle write path: 100K+ TPS, sub-millisecond, double-entry enforced at write time.
  • Arbitrum Orbit (Stylus) settlement with AnyTrust DAC: proof public, enterprise data never.
  • Stablecoin-native gas, CCTP, and GENIUS-aligned via permitted issuers.

The moat: real flows from day one

  • Launches on Tilli's live rails, serving 20M+ consumers.
  • 1,000+ TPS in production today.
  • A fiat engine feeds the chain: ACH, wire, FedNow, and ERP sync with QuickBooks, SAP, Oracle, and NetSuite out of the box.
